About Chinazo O. Cunningham
Chinazo O. Cunningham is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Infectious Diseases, General Health Professions and Pharmacology, having authored 161 papers that have together received 5.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include HIV, Drug Use, Sexual Risk (77 papers), Opioid Use Disorder Treatment (65 papers), HIV/AIDS Research and Interventions (62 papers), Substance Abuse Treatment and Outcomes (45 papers), Cannabis and Cannabinoid Research (21 papers), Prenatal Substance Exposure Effects (18 papers), Homelessness and Social Issues (17 papers) and Pain Management and Opioid Use (13 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Infectious Diseases (1.9k citations), Epidemiology (3.0k citations),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health (1.9k citations), Virology (263 citations) and General Health Professions (1.3k citations). Chinazo O. Cunningham has collaborated with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and China. Frequent co-authors include Nancy Sohler, Marcus A. Bachhuber, Joanna L. Starrels, Brendan Saloner, Colleen L. Barry, Aaron D. Fox, Laramie R. Smith, Hillary V. Kunins, Sean Hennessy and William E. Cunningham. Their work appears in journals such as AIDS Patient Care and STDs, Substance Abuse, Journal of Substance Abuse Treatment, AIDS Care and Drug and Alcohol Dependence.
